He followed this with a supernatural romantic comedy titled Kiss Me Goodbye (1982) and then, due to personal conflicts, dropped out of the spotlight for several years before returning with a stellar performance under old friend Francis Ford Coppola in the moving Gardens of Stone (1987).Caan appeared back in favor with fans and critics alike and raised his visibility with the sci-fi hit Alien Nation (1988) and Dick Tracy (1990), then surprised everyone by playing a meek romance novelist held captive after a car accident by a deranged fan in the dynamic Misery (1990). Caan then went on to star in string of high-profile films in the 1970s that bracketed him firmly in the new generation of American acting talent, including The Gambler (directed by Karel Reisz), buddy cop comedy Freebie and the Bean alongside Alan Arkin, and dystopian sci-fi parable Rollerball. However, the decade produced one of Caans most enduring and acclaimed roles as safecracker Frank in director Michael Manns cult favorite Thief, with Caan like Sonny a decade earlier turning an otherwise despicable person into an audience-beloved antihero. Caan spent the remainder of the Seventies as a leading man, headlining films like Sam Peckinpahs The Killer Elite, Richard Attenboroughs war epic A Bridge Too Far and the adaptation of Neil Simons Chapter Two.
